Summer really is a state of mind, especially during the cold months in Southern California. Nothing can prove it more than the right live musical soundtrack. For many fans the world over, this soundtrack is Surf Music, the instrumental genre created in the early 60.s by legendary bands such as The Belairs and Eddie & The Showmen. Helping to keep this instro torch alive and well are the members of the online forum SurfGuitar101.com, who have put together some of the most significant live Surf Music events in recent years. The 2nd annual Winter Surf Fest will continue along these lines, featuring an entire day of the reverb-drenched goodness, complete with rare tribute and reunion performances, and the US public debut screening of the new Surf Music documentary film Reverb Junkies. This special Sunday event coincides with one of the most important music weekends in Southern California that includes Deke Dickerson’s Guitar Geek Festival and the NAMM trade show in Anaheim, and the So Cal World Guitar Show at the Orange County Fairgrounds.

2nd Annual Winter Surf Fest Highlights:
–A very special US public debut screening of the brand-new Surf Music documentary film Reverb Junkies at 10AM, with the filmmakers present. DVDs of the film will be available for purchase.
–A tribute performance by John Blair (Jon & The Nightriders), Dick Dodd (The Belairs, Eddie & The Showmen, The Standells), Jim Frias (The Nocturnes) with High Tide, to the great Surf Guitar pioneer Eddie Bertrand (The Belairs, Eddie & The Showmen), who recently passed away
–A Rare Belairs reunion performance featuring original members Paul Johnson, Dick Dodd, and Jimmy Roberts with special guests
–A rare Southern California performance by modern Bay Area Surf masters The TomorrowMen
–A performance by Surf/Garage/Frat band extraordinaire The Volcanics
–A performance by San Pedro traditional surf maestros The Riptides
–A performance by Southern California 60s tribute band Banned From the Beach

Machine gun staccato guitars drenched in dripping reverb, twangy plunk, bouncing bass, driving, tribal drums………most are unaware that the musical genre known as “Surf” that was catapulted onto the radar of modern pop-culture by Pulp Fiction has evolved and developed into a full-blown sub-culture with fanatic followers, complete with its own online ground zero, a website called (what else?) surfguitar101.com.

Once a year, the fanatics convene for a marathon 12-hour festival of all things surf–live performances by 8 of the best bands in the genre from all over the world, a “Living Legends of Surf Jam,” which features performance collaborations from the original players that were there back in the genre’s 60s beginnings, a surf music and memorabilia marketplace, and an extremely generous raffle featuring music, clothing, collectibles, and musical instruments and accessories from prominent makers/sponsors such as Fender, Eastwood, Nocturne Pedals and many more!

Now in its 5th year, the Surf Guitar 101 Convention has grown from a small gathering of geeks, to an all-out international festival, drawing attendees and interest from across the globe to Los Alamitos. Starting Gate, an all-age concert venue with full food menu and bar. 2012 promises to be the largest convention yet, with substantially increased advertising, marketing and corporate sponsorship.

5th Annual Convention Highlights:

–A historic reunion performance by the band that re-ignited interest in Surf Music in the 80s andushered in the so-called “Second Wave,” JON & THE NIGHTRIDERS –A Live set by the group that many consider the best modern surf band in the world, direct from Indiana, featuring material from their new album Tribal Fires, THE MADEIRA –A performance by Denmark Surf rockers El Ray, on their first American tour –The second US visit by Euro-Instro/Surf/Ska/Soul troupe Los Venturas from Belgium –From Wisconsin, one of the best traditional surf mainstays since 1994, The Exotics –Direct from Florida, Southeast Surf/Rockabilly/Space masters The Intoxicators! –Local Orange County, California Hot Rod/Surf legends The Dynotones–Celebrating their 6th album, East Coast Surf, Sci-Fi, Spy, Hot-Rod veterans 9th Wave –Incredible live reunion performances by first wave bands The Rumblers, of I Don’t Need You No More and Boss fame, and Southern California’s own The Nocturnes, famous for the classic Third Star from the Left

Tales from the Tiki Lounge is the rarest, hardest to find, and most collectible, Pulp-Adventure publication never made. It existed only in the Mai-Tai light Zone of Brad (Tiki Shark) Parker‘s imagination. These paintings are the cover-art of the most desired and sought after issues. So precious that they are nearly beyond price, and believability.

“Brad Parker creates lurid paintings that pull in influences from tiki, comics, and rock.” – Honolulu Magazine, “The Best Of 2012 “

“My art is my personal celebration of a creative reinvention of a foolish misinterpretation of an ancient mythology that sought to solve the mystery of the “breath of life” that eternally and precariously surfs the complete expanse between the bottomless sea and the floating shadow land of preexistence in the inconceivable heights of the sky. Not just to live. But, to ‘live aloha’.” -Brad Parker

Preview Brad’s show here

Miles Thompson’s Warm Fuzzies, Cold Pricklies, a show created with Gouache on illustration board, reflects on what makes life both a beach and a bitch. It is an epitaph for the oceans and forests, once abundant and fecund (look it up, it is the root of the F bomb), now only a ghostly reminder of what an infinite life giving power they once were. There is more than just an environmental message here, Warm Fuzzies, Cold Pricklies is also a joyful reminder for us all to frolic around and about the impermanence we all face day to day while we are blessed with a heart, body and mind. Life happens between the lullaby and the nightmare, having and losing. Everything in-between is either a memory that we don’t want to fade, or which is sadly indelible.

Thompson, whose influences range from the ephemeral world of comics, animation and album cover art to centuries of fine art and sculpture, is a native Californian residing in Hollywood who draws, paints, reads, writes, hikes, runs, surfs and meditates. He is most inspired by his daughter who he calls his butterfly.
